Job Summary:

We are seeking an energetic and detail-oriented Event Marketing Assistant to join our dynamic team. As the Event Marketing Assistant, you will be responsible for supporting the marketing team in executing strategic marketing plans for our events. This is a fast-paced and hands-on role that requires strong communication skills, creative thinking, and excellent organizational abilities. The ideal candidate will have a passion for events and marketing, and a desire to be part of a growing company.

 

Key Responsibilities:

• Assist in developing and implementing marketing strategies for events

• Collaborate with the marketing team to create engaging content for social media platforms, website, and email campaigns

• Conduct market research and analyze industry trends to identify new opportunities for event promotions

• Monitor and report on the effectiveness of marketing campaigns

• Assist in the creation of event materials such as invitations, advertisements, and signage

• Coordinate with vendors and partners to secure event sponsorships and partnerships

• Support event logistics, including set-up, break-down, and on-site event management

• Provide excellent customer service to event attendees and ensure their satisfaction

• Maintain event databases and track marketing ROI

• Other duties as assigned by the marketing manager or event coordinator

 

Qualifications:

•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field preferred

• Strong communication skills, both written and verbal

• Creative thinking and problem-solving abilities

• Proven 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ines

• Strong attention to detail and organizational skills

• Positive attitude and ability to work well in a team environment

• Previous experience in event planning or logistics is a plus
